PedalStart led Rs 1.2 Cr Pre-seed funding raised by insurtech startup Healspan

The pre-seed funding round led by PedalStart has brought in Rs 1.2 crore for the insurance-tech startup Healspan, based in Bengaluru. Healspan has received funding totaling Rs 1.7 crore thus far.

According to a press release from Healspan, the money will be used to support the company’s technology, hiring practices, and general business operations and expansion.

Healspan, which was co-founded in 2022 by Sabrinath U and Abhi Sinha, provides healthcare facilities with streamlined cashless insurance claims, eliminating several obstacles and hurdles. According to Healspan, clients can expedite the processing of past-due insurance claims by thirty percent and resolve them in less than ninety days.

Healspan asserts that its revenue increased by 4X and that it has been concentrating on growing the company’s paid subscriber base and new revenue streams.

The startup operates in tier-I cities and several metropolises, including Bengaluru, Chennai, Hyderabad, Delhi-NCR, and Mumbai. By the end of 2025, it hopes to have expanded to additional locations throughout India and be serving at least 1,000 hospitals.

The co-founder of PedalStart recently spoke with media stating that the company hopes to onboard 2,000 founders into its community this fiscal year and that it will invest in and accelerate close to 40 startups.
